Summary:
Argentine cuisine is one of the world's best-kept culinary secrets. This cookbook highlights the dishes of nine different regions, providing 190 easy-to-follow recipes that have been adapted for the North American kitchen. A helpful section on ingredients and techniques ensures that even novice cooks can produce spectacular results.
